Transaction eaafecc24dfe59acba90e7c7382fcec65f96a1ba3a3ed0e1143ee135a452981a
1 Input
1 Output
-
eaafecc24dfe59acba90e7c7382fcec65f96a1ba3a3ed0e1143ee135a452981a:0
- value
- 993373
- script pubkey
- OP_0 OP_PUSHBYTES_20 df1a4901c360172f0f870789249ad3478833ca88
- address
- bc1qmudyjqwrvqtj7ru8q7yjfxkng7yr8j5gg5zaxc